Which expression is equivalent to this polynomial expression? (5xy^2 + 3x^2 – 7) + (3x^2y^2 – xy^2 + 3y^2 + 4) A. 3.x^2y^2 + 4xy^2 + 3x^2 + 3y^2 – 3 B. 9x^2y^2 + 4xy^2 – 3 C. 3x^2y^2 + 6xy^2 + 6x^2 + 3 D. 8x^2y^2 + 2xy^2 - 4y^2 + 4

Answers

Answer 1

According to the given data we have the following polynomial expression:

(5xy^2 + 3x^2 – 7) + (3x^2y^2 – xy^2 + 3y^2 + 4)

To find out which expression is equivalent to the one above, we woule have to make the following calculation:

First:

\(\mathrm{Remove\: parentheses}\colon\quad \mleft(a\mright)=a\)\(=5xy^2+3x^2-7+3x^2y^2-xy^2+3y^2+4\)

Next, group like terms:

\(=3x^2y^2+3x^2+5xy^2-xy^2+3y^2-7+4\)

Next, add similar elements:

\(3x^2y^2+3x^2+4xy^2+3y^2-7+4\)\(\mathrm{Add/Subtract\: the\: numbers\colon}\: -7+4=-3\)

So we would get the following equivalent expression:

\(=3x^2y^2+3x^2+4xy^2+3y^2-3\)

Therefore, the right option would be A.

Quadrilateral EFGH is an isosceles trapezoid with bases EH and FG. The measure of angle HGF is (9y + 3)°, and the measure of angle EFG is (8y + 5)°. What is the measure of angle HGF?

Answers

Answer:

21°

Step-by-step explanation:

In an sosceles trapezoid, the lower base and upper base angles are congurent

⇒ ∠HGF = ∠EFG

⇒ 9y + 3 = 8y + 5

⇒ 9y - 8y = 5 - 3

⇒ y = 2

⇒ ∠HGF = 9(2) + 3

= 18 + 3

= 21

Final answer:

The measure of angle HGF in the given isosceles trapezoid EFGH is calculated to be 21 degrees.

Explanation:

This problem deals with the properties of an isosceles trapezoid, which is a type of quadrilateral. In an isosceles trapezoid, opposite angles are equal. In this case, angle EFG and angle HGF would be equal to each other given the shape is an isosceles trapezoid. So, their measures should be equal.

Here, the measure of angle HGF is given as (9y + 3)°, and the measure of angle EFG is (8y + 5)°. Setting these equal to each other to find the value of y, we get 9y + 3 = 8y + 5. By simplifying, we get the value of y is 2. Substituting the found value of y in angle HGF we get, 9*2+3 = 21 degrees.

The number of bacteria in a sample is increasing according to an exponential model. After four hours, the sample contained 400 bacteria. After twelve hours, the sample contained 1,600 bacteria. Write an exponential growth model for the number of bacteria in the sample after x hours.

Please Help! I need this by tomorrow! I will give BRAINLIESTThe number of bacteria in a sample is increasing

Answers

The solution is Option A.

The exponential growth model for the number of bacteria in the sample after x hours is    \(P ( x ) = 200 e ^{(\frac{ln 4}{8})x }\)

What is exponential growth factor?

The exponential growth or decay formula is given by

x ( t ) = x₀ × ( 1 + r )ⁿ

x ( t ) is the value at time t

x₀ is the initial value at time t = 0.

r is the growth rate when r>0 or decay rate when r<0, in percent

t is the time in discrete intervals and selected time units

Given data ,

Let the equation for the number of bacteria in the sample after x hours = P

The value of the equation P ( x ) is given by

After 4 hours , the sample contained 400 bacteria

So ,

when x = 4

\(P ( 4 ) = ae ^{4b }=400\)   be equation (1)

After 12 hours , the sample contained 1600 bacteria

And , when x = 12

\(P ( 12 ) = ae ^{12b }=1600\)   be equation (2)

Divide equation (2) by equation (1) , we get

\(\frac{P ( 12 )}{P ( 4 )} = \frac{ae ^{12b }}{ae ^{4b }} = \frac{1600}{400}\)

On simplifying the equation , we get

e¹²ᵇ⁻⁴ᵇ = 4

e⁸ᵇ = 4

Taking logarithm on both sides of the equation , we get

8b = ln (4)

Divide by 8 on both sides , we get

b = ln (4) / 8

Substituting the value for b in equation (1) , we get

\(ae ^{4*ln (4) / 8 }=400\)

\(ae ^{ln (4) / 2}=400\)

On simplifying the equation , we get

a x 2 = 400

Divide by 2 on both sides of the equation , we get

a = 200

Therefore , the exponential growth equation is given by

Substitute the values of a and b in the equation , we get

\(P ( x ) = 200 e ^{(\frac{ln 4}{8})x }\)

Hence , The exponential growth model for the number of bacteria in the sample after x hours is    \(P ( x ) = 200 e ^{(\frac{ln 4}{8})x }\)
